Warning Signs You Need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al
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can lead to costly repairs and health hazards if left unchecked. Stay vigilant and take action quickly to prevent further damage.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your shower or surrounding areas, it’s likely due to mold growth. Don’t ignore this sign it can lead to serious health issues if left unchecked.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ls near your shower, it’s a sign of a larger issue. Don’t delay call us today to schedule a Shower Pan Leak Water Removal service.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
If your flooring is warped or buckled near your shower, it’s a sign of water damage. Don’t wait call us today to schedule a Shower Pan Leak Water Removal service.
Visible Water Damage
If you notice visible water damage on your walls, ceiling, or flooring near your shower, it’s a sign of a serious issue. Don’t delay call us today to schedule a Shower Pan Leak Water Removal service.
Discoloration or Staining on Your Shower Pan
If your shower pan is discolored or stained, it’s a sign of mineral buildup. Don’t ignore this sign it can lead to further damage if left unchecked.

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Cost in Alpine, NJ
The cost of Shower Pan Leak Water Removal var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Alpine, NJ. Our team will provide a customized estimate after assessing the damage and developing a plan to remove the water and dry your space.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| The cost of water removal depends on the amount of water present and the size of the affected area.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the amount of moisture present. |
| Cleanup and Disinfection | $100 – $500 | The cost of cleanup and disinfection depends on the extent of the damage and the type of materials affected. |
| Reconstruction and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| The cost of reconstruction and repair depends on the extent of the damage and the type of materials affected. |
